STOP AND START SYSTEM PROBLEM SYMPTOMS TABLE
Use the table below to help determine the cause of problem symptoms. If multiple suspected areas are listed, the potential causes of the symptoms are listed in order of probability in the "Suspected Area" column of the table. Check each symptom by checking the suspected areas in the order they are listed. Replace parts as necessary.
Inspect the fuses and relays related to this system before inspecting the suspected areas below.

*1: If the vehicle has not been used for a long time, the battery charge may be low and stop and start control operation may be prohibited. In this case, recharge the battery, initialize the integrated current* using the GTS and drive the vehicle approximately 5 to 40 minutes until refresh charge is completed and stop and start control operation is permitted.
*: Use the GTS to perform Integrated Current Value Initialization.
